Hey Product Hunt! I'm Mo, solo developer behind Tomadora.

The idea came from a simple observation: I use focus timers daily, but every 5-minute break turned into 20 minutes of doom-scrolling. What if those breaks could actually teach me something?

Tomadora sits in your menu bar, runs a strict focus timer, and when break time hits, it serves you a flashcard or quiz from whatever you're learning. The spaced repetition algorithm (SM-2 with 5-point self-rating, like Anki) ensures you actually retain what you learn.

I've been using it myself to learn German, and the compound effect is real — 6 breaks a day = 30 minutes of spaced repetition practice without any extra screen time.

Tech stack: Electron + React + TypeScript, Express backend, Prisma + PostgreSQL, Google Gemini for course generation, SM-2 spaced repetition.
